Step 1: Ensure Your Webroot Purchase

Before proceeding with the download, make sure that you have completed your Webroot purchase and have received the necessary product details. Here are a few things to check before you start:

  1. Email Confirmation: After purchasing Webroot, you should receive a confirmation email from Webroot. This email will typically contain your license key or activation code and might also include instructions on how to download Webroot for your devices.

  2. Webroot Account: Make sure you have an active Webroot account, as it’s necessary to activate the software. If you don’t have an account, you can create one during the installation process.

  3. License Key: This is important for activating Webroot on your device. You should have this key ready before beginning the installation.

If you have all of these, you’re ready to proceed with the download.

Step 2: Access the Google Play Store

Webroot for Android can only be downloaded from the Google Play Store, which is the official app store for Android devices. Here’s how to find and download Webroot:

  1. Open Google Play Store: On your Android device, open the Google Play Store app. This app is pre-installed on all Android devices.

  2. Search for Webroot: In the search bar at the top of the screen, type in "Webroot" and press the Enter or Search button. This will bring up the Webroot apps available for download.

  3. Select Webroot Security: There are a few different versions of Webroot apps available for Android, depending on the type of device and protection you want. Typically, the app you’ll need is Webroot Mobile Security or Webroot SecureAnywhere. Select the correct Webroot app from the search results.

  4. Check the App Details: Before proceeding with the download, make sure you review the app details. You should check for information such as:

    • The developer name (it should be Webroot, Inc.)
    • Ratings and reviews: This can give you an idea of the app’s performance on Android devices.
    • Compatibility: Ensure that the app is compatible with your version of Android.

Step 3: Download and Install Webroot on Your Android Device

After you have selected the correct Webroot app, you can download and install it onto your device.

  1. Click on the Install Button: Once you've verified that you’ve selected the correct Webroot app, click on the Install button. The app will start downloading and automatically install on your Android device.

  2. Wait for the Installation: The download time will vary depending on your internet speed, but it shouldn’t take long. Once the app is fully downloaded, it will automatically install on your device.

  3. Open the App: Once installed, you’ll see the Webroot app icon on your home screen or in your apps list. Tap on the icon to open the app.

Step 4: Activate Webroot on Your Android Device

Now that you’ve installed the Webroot app, the next step is to activate it with your purchased license key. Activation ensures that you can use all the features of Webroot Mobile Security, such as real-time protection, anti-theft features, and safe browsing tools.

Here’s how to activate Webroot on your Android device:

  1. Open the Webroot App: After tapping the Webroot icon, the app will launch, and you will be prompted to sign in or activate the app.

  2. Sign in to Your Webroot Account: If you already have a Webroot account, sign in using your email and password. This account is where your license key is stored and will allow the app to be activated. If you don’t have an account, you can create one during this step.

  3. Enter Your License Key: If you’re prompted for an activation code or license key, enter the key you received when you made the purchase. This key is typically sent to you in your confirmation email or may be available on your Webroot account page.

  4. Activate: Once the key is entered, tap the Activate button. The app should confirm that your Webroot product is now activated, and the features of the app will become available.

  5. Complete the Setup: After activation, Webroot may ask you to configure additional settings, such as enabling automatic scans, setting up privacy controls, or activating anti-theft features.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the setup process.

Step 5: Run the Initial Scan

Once you’ve activated Webroot on your Android device, it’s a good idea to run an initial scan to check for any existing threats on your device. Here’s how to do it:

  1. Start a Scan: In the Webroot app, you should see an option to start a scan. Tap on it to begin the process.

  2. Wait for the Scan to Complete: The scan may take a few minutes, depending on the number of apps and files on your device. Webroot will check for malware, viruses, and other types of online threats.

  3. Review the Results: Once the scan is complete, Webroot will show you the results. If it finds any issues, it will provide options to resolve them, such as quarantining or deleting suspicious files.

  4. Enable Ongoing Protection: You can enable real-time protection so that Webroot continuously scans your device for threats in the background. This ensures that your Android device remains protected at all times.

Step 6: Update Webroot and Your Android Device

After installing Webroot, it’s a good idea to check for updates to ensure you have the latest protection. Updates are essential for staying protected against the latest threats.

  1. Update Webroot: Go to the Google Play Store, search for Webroot, and if an update is available, tap Update. Updates typically include bug fixes, new features, and more robust security measures.

  2. Update Your Android OS: Also, make sure your Android device’s operating system is up to date. Go to Settings > System > Software Update, and check if any updates are available for your Android version. Keeping your OS up to date helps ensure that your device is protected from vulnerabilities.

Troubleshooting Webroot Installation on Android

If you encounter any issues while downloading or installing Webroot on your Android device, here are a few troubleshooting steps:

  1. Check for Compatibility: Ensure that your Android device is running a supported version of Android (usually Android 5.0 and above).

  2. Clear Cache: If the Google Play Store is not allowing you to download Webroot, try clearing the cache and data for the Play Store app by going to Settings > Apps > Google Play Store > Storage > Clear Cache.

  3. Reboot Your Device: Sometimes, restarting your Android device can resolve installation issues or glitches.

  4. Check Your License Key: If you’re having trouble activating Webroot, double-check that you’ve entered the correct license key. If necessary, contact Webroot support for assistance.
